  Spruce Grove sports physiotherapist pain guide Why Pain Can Increase After Physical Activity It’s common for people to feel more discomfort after exercise or sports. This can be confusing, especially when movement is meant to support healing. A sports physiotherapist often explains that increased pain after activity is linked to how tissues respond to stress during recovery. In Spruce Grove, many individuals notice symptoms hours after activity rather than during it. This delayed response is part of how the body reacts to strain or minor injury. Understanding Delayed Pain Response When muscles or ligaments are stressed, small tears can occur. These are a normal part of adaptation, but if the load is too high, it can lead to irritation.   A minor car accident may not always seem serious at first. Many people walk away feeling fine, only to notice discomfort hours or days later. Stiffness in the neck, soreness in the back, or mild headaches can gradually appear and begin to affect daily activities. This is where searching for mva physiotherapy near me becomes relevant. MVA (motor vehicle accident) physiotherapy focuses on identifying and treating injuries that occur during collisions, even those considered minor. Clinics such as Sunrise Physical Therapy Spruce Grove provide structured care to help individuals recover safely and return to their routines. Why Minor Accidents Should Not Be Ignored After a low-impact collision, the body may not immediately show signs of injury. Adrenaline can mask pain, and some symptoms take time to develop.   Core strength plays an important role in movement, posture, and physical stability. Many people associate the core only with abdominal muscles, but the core system includes several muscle groups that work together to support the spine and pelvis. One of the less discussed components of the core is the pelvic floor muscles. Pelvic floor muscles support internal organs, assist in bladder control, and contribute to stability during physical activity. In men, these muscles also influence balance, lifting ability, and coordination.  Dizziness, vertigo, and balance problems can affect daily life in subtle but serious ways. Many people delay care, assuming symptoms will pass. However, understanding when to begin vestibular rehabilitation therapy Spruce Grove can help prevent long-term discomfort and improve movement confidence. Understanding Vestibular Physiotherapy Vestibular physiotherapy focuses on the inner ear and how it connects to balance and spatial awareness. When this system is disrupted, people may feel unsteady, lightheaded, or experience spinning sensations. This type of therapy uses guided exercises to retrain the brain and body. It helps restore coordination between the eyes, inner ear, and muscles.
